The CRMC-Metaplanet Deal: A Forensic Look at the Bitcoin Treasury Illusion

Check the source code, not the roadmap. When a US asset manager becomes the largest shareholder of Japan's so-called 'Bitcoin Treasury' company, the market reads it as institutional vindication. I read it as a structural red flag.

Metaplanet announced that CRMC, a US investment advisory firm, increased its stake from 9.32% to 10.63%, becoming the top shareholder. The narrative writes itself: 'US money trusts Japanese bitcoin strategy.' But narrative is cheap. The real story is in the balance sheet, the governance, and the single-point-of-failure risk that this transaction does nothing to mitigate – in fact, it concentrates it further.

Context: A Treasury with No Diversification

Metaplanet is a publicly listed firm in Tokyo that holds roughly 400+ bitcoins as its primary reserve asset. It is frequently called 'Japan's MicroStrategy.' CRMC is a traditional asset manager with $X billion AUM (not disclosed in the release, but likely significant). The transaction is a simple secondary market purchase of shares. No new capital was raised for Metaplanet. No additional bitcoins were bought.

The entire 'bull case' hinges on the assumption that CRMC will now use its board influence to push Metaplanet to borrow more money or issue equity to buy more bitcoin. That is an expectation, not a fact. And in my experience auditing corporate treasuries and smart contracts, expectation is the most dangerous vector.

Core Analysis: The Three Systemic Vulnerabilities

First, the single-asset treasury risk. Metaplanet's balance sheet is a leveraged bet on bitcoin. If bitcoin drops 50%, the company's market cap follows, potentially triggering margin calls if they used debt. CRMC's presence does not change this; it amplifies it. A large shareholder with a 10.63% stake now has the incentive to push for riskier leverage to juice short-term returns, because they can diversify their own portfolio elsewhere. The minority retail shareholders – the ones who bought into the 'treasury' narrative – bear the asymmetric downside.

Second, the governance centralization. With 10.63% voting power, CRMC can influence board elections and major strategic decisions. But CRMC is not a crypto-native firm; it is a traditional asset manager bound by US fiduciary duties. Their primary loyalty is to their own LPs, not to Metaplanet's vision. The potential for conflict is high: CRMC might force a sale of the bitcoin holdings to realize gains, or push for a dividend payout that benefits them at the expense of long-term accumulation. The 'stewardship' narrative is a mask for centralized control.

Third, the indirect exposure paradox. Why did CRMC not buy bitcoin directly via an ETF? Because that would require direct custody, regulatory complexity, and mark-to-market volatility on their books. By buying Metaplanet stock, they get a leveraged, opaque, and diluted form of bitcoin exposure, wrapped in the comfort of traditional stock settlement. This is not adoption; it is a hedge against being early. It tells me that institutions still fear direct crypto exposure, so they create synthetic proxies that introduce counterparty risk. Fully audited? The stock is audited, but the underlying asset's volatility is not.

Let me be precise: this transaction increases the correlation between Metaplanet's stock and bitcoin, but adds a new variable – CRMC's future actions. From my 2017 ICO analysis experience, I learned that any time a large entity acquires a controlling stake in a hyped asset, the probability of a liquidity event (sell-off) rises.

Contrarian Angle: What the Bulls Got Right

I will concede that this event does provide a marginal positive signal for the 'institutional adoption' narrative. It proves that traditional capital allocators are willing to use corporate equity as a vehicle for bitcoin exposure. That is a step beyond the mere existence of ETFs. It also gives Metaplanet a credible institutional partner that can facilitate cheaper debt financing. If CRMC uses its network to help Metaplanet issue convertible bonds at favorable rates, that could accelerate bitcoin accumulation.

But the key word is 'if.' The current transaction is a passive secondary purchase. The bullish narrative requires active future steps that are not guaranteed. The market is pricing in optionality, not execution. Hype is just noise in the signal.

Furthermore, CRMC's move could be a signal to other Japanese firms. If they follow, the aggregate corporate demand for bitcoin in Japan could increase, supporting prices. That is a genuine positive externality. However, it is a second-order effect with low confidence. The first-order effect – the actual change in Metaplanet's balance sheet – is zero.

Takeaway: The Accountability Call

The real takeaway is not that 'institutions are coming.' It is that the bitcoin treasury model remains structurally fragile, and this transaction concentrates fragility into a single decision node: CRMC. If the math doesn't add up, the narrative is the vulnerability.

Check the source code of the governance structure, not the press release. Metaplanet's corporate bylaws, the rights of majority shareholders, the absence of any protection for minority holders against a forced sale – these are the real attack vectors. I have seen this pattern before: a 'visionary' company gets a large institutional backer, the backer's time horizon shortens, and the retail bag is left holding the volatility.

In a bull market, such news is celebrated. But for those of us who trace the dependencies, this is a warning. The sequencer of corporate governance is centralized; CRMC now controls one of the keys. Trust the hash of the balance sheet, not the hand of the institutional partner. 'Fully audited' applies to the financial statements, but the systemic risk of a single-asset treasury is not an audit finding – it is a design flaw.

I will be watching the next quarterly filing for any debt increase. If Metaplanet announces a significant borrowing round, the real game begins. Until then, this is noise with a ticker attached.
